THE WARBEAST IS BACK (hopefully for good this time)

AM- Pretty sick morning 4 with Connor Baller and the pv crew (probably a record turnout as well). Super proud of what our guys are accomplishing so far this track season... Especially our younger guys.

PM- 10 warm/cool, 800-1000m@1600 goal pace (full recovery), 2-4x400@3200 pace, 2-4x400@1600 pace, 2-4x400@1600 goal pace. I did okay this workout, but the short day at school kind of threw off my eating schedule and I was running full which is never fun. Alex and I went the full 1000 and hit a 2:49. I don't think I was fully recovered after 10 minutes, but went on with the workout anyways. Went on to do 9 of the possible 12 400s (i don't think anyone could hit all 12 today on the boy's side) at 1:14, 1:14, 1:13, 1:14, 1:10, 1:09, 1:07, 1:07, 1:09. Didn't really feel my best today, but that 1000 gave me confidence that I can run a state qualifying time in the 1600 if I really put my mind to it. Good day. Weights afterward. AM- 4 miles easy Starbucks. Today started with only 3 guys:me, logan, and Mikey. Like coach said, the guys who show up to morning practice show the most improvement and Mikey and Logan are awesome examples of that: with Mikey getting 10:30ish in the 3200 yesterday (freshman) and logan with like a 2:05 in the 800 (soph). We ended the run with 7 guys (Dallen Mitch Carson and Andrew all showed up late) and those guys are all beasts too.

PM- Hit a bunch of miles at the meet. Raced the 1600 which was supposed to start at 8:30 but then was changed to 8:00, back to 8:30, and ended up being ran at like 8:45... Felt like Hurricane invite all over again ;) but ANYWAYS, my race was going really well, I was in like 4th with 500 meters to go, and pretty much on state qualifying pace... And then I died. I literally felt more tired than I ever had in any 1600 of my life, my legs could not move any faster and started to go a lot slower... Finished like way far back with a high 4:40s (i think) and was not very proud of my performance. Idk if it was because of the race being so late at night or what, but I know this wasn't anywhere near my best. I ran 4:39 in cross postseason, so I think I should be around 4:32 next time. This race was a fluke: not big deal.
